RAID-контроллер показывает 2 массива с использованием одинаковых дисков

У нас есть сервер с 3ware RAID-контроллером, который сегодня перешел в режим только для чтения из-за прерванного журнала ext4. Я проверил состояние RAID и обнаружил следующую странную конфигурацию:

//host> /c3/u1 show

Unit     UnitType  Status         %RCmpl  %V/I/M  Port  Stripe  Size(GB)
------------------------------------------------------------------------
u1       RAID-5    INOPERABLE     -       -       -     64K     11175.8
u1-0     DISK      OK             -       -       p0    -       1862.63
u1-1     DISK      DEGRADED       -       -       -     -       1862.63
u1-2     DISK      DEGRADED       -       -       -     -       1862.63
u1-3     DISK      DEGRADED       -       -       -     -       1862.63
u1-4     DISK      DEGRADED       -       -       -     -       1862.63
u1-5     DISK      DEGRADED       -       -       -     -       1862.63
u1-6     DISK      DEGRADED       -       -       -     -       1862.63
u1/v0    Volume    -              -       -       -     -       11175.8

//host> /c3/u0 show

Unit     UnitType  Status         %RCmpl  %V/I/M  Port  Stripe  Size(GB)
------------------------------------------------------------------------
u0       RAID-5    OK             -       -       -     64K     11175.8
u0-0     DISK      OK             -       -       p7    -       1862.63
u0-1     DISK      OK             -       -       p1    -       1862.63
u0-2     DISK      OK             -       -       p2    -       1862.63
u0-3     DISK      OK             -       -       p3    -       1862.63
u0-4     DISK      OK             -       -       p4    -       1862.63
u0-5     DISK      OK             -       -       p5    -       1862.63
u0-6     DISK      OK             -       -       p6    -       1862.63
u0/v0    Volume    -              -       -       -     -       11175.8

У меня также есть несколько из следующих предупреждений в журнале:

c3   [Wed Oct 08 2014 02:08:02]  WARNING   Sector repair completed: port=7, LBA=0x27000380

Есть также немного более старое сообщение о неполном массиве, сопровождаемое сообщением "диск вставлен: порт =0".

Предполагается, что диск p0 является запасным, но внезапно это единственный диск в массиве, который выглядит идентично основному массиву. Есть идеи, что здесь произошло?

Мой план исправить это будет удалить p0 из массива u1, удалить весь массив u1 и пометить p0 как запасной. После этого я бы удалил p7 из массива, поскольку он кажется ненадежным, и перестроил массив, используя p0.

Это похоже на разумный план? Я немного волнуюсь, так как не понимаю, почему есть два массива и что именно произошло.

Я знаю, что RAID 5 проблематичен с такими большими дисками, но сейчас я ничего не могу изменить

1 ответ

Есть ли шанс, что это двухканальные диски SAS с обоими каналами, подключенными к одному контроллеру? Немного далеко, но это может объяснить, почему диски видны дважды.

Диски содержат конфигурацию на контроллерах 3Ware, поэтому, если я прав, администратор может видеть одну и ту же конфигурацию дважды, а потом удивляться, почему он может записывать только один "набор" дисков. Исходя из этого, я бы не предложил удалять U1. Только подключите один канал на диск, и U1 должен просто уйти.

НТН!

Другие вопросы по тегам